On January 25, 2001 at 17:01:41, David Rasmussen wrote:

>[D]1k1r1bnr/ppp1qbpp/3p2n1/3Pp3/N3Pp2/1QN2P2/PPP1BBPP/R2R2K1 w - - 0 1
>
>I made this up a couple of minutes ago, at random. I was quite sure that there
>would something tactical in it for white. It turned out there was, starting with
>Nb5. But my program took 57 seconds to fail high the first time at depth 11,
>only to get a score of 0.85 at research. I wouldn't say that Chezzz understood
>what happened until depth 12, where it fails high with +1.18 and gets +2.06 at
>research. This took 570 seconds...
>
>I'm sure a lot of programs will see this within the first second or so...

Chessmaster 8000 (default settings, on a PIII-600) does pretty much the same
thing:

Time	Depth	Score	Positions	Moves
0:00	4	0.77	4219		1. Nb5 a6 2. Na3 b5 3. Nc4
0:00	5	0.74	10987		1. Nb5 a6 2. Na3 b5 3. Nc4 Nf6
0:00	6	0.82	52345		1. Nb5 a6 2. Na3 Ka8 3. Nc3 b5
0:02	7	0.74	173686		1. Nb5 a6 2. Na3 Ka8 3. Nc3 b5
					4. Qb4 Nf6
0:11	8	0.78	792454		1. Nb5 a6 2. Na3 Ka8 3. Nc3 Nf6
					4. Rac1 b5
0:22	8	0.96	1570374		1. Qb5 Be8 2. Qa5 b6 3. Qa6 Rc8
					4. b3 c5 5. Nb2 Qb7
0:32	9	1.07	2301860		1. Qb5 Be8 2. Qa5 b6 3. Qa6 Rc8
					4. Bb5 Bxb5 5. Nxb5 c6 6. Na3
2:20	10	1.16	10694071	1. Qb5 Be8 2. Qa5 b6 3. Qa6 Rc8
					4. Bb5 Bxb5 5. Nxb5 c6 6. dxc6
					Rxc6 7. Nac3 Nf6
6:47	10	1.73	30819461	1. Nb5 a6 2. Na7 Ka8 3. Bxa6 bxa6
					4. Nc6 Qg5 5. Qc4 Kb7 6. Nxd8+
					Qxd8 7. Qc6+ Kb8 8. Qxa6
13:16	11	3.19	62030810	1. Nb5 c5 2. dxc6 bxc6 3. Bxa7+
					Qxa7+ 4. Nxa7+ Bxb3 5. Nxc6+ Kc7
					6. Nxd8 Bxa4 7. Nf7 Nf6 8. b3 Bc6
					9. Nxh8 Nxh8
